Hermosa Beach is one of the South Bay’s most vibrant coastal communities, known for its walkable beach lifestyle, lively downtown, and strong neighborhood identity. The city offers a relaxed yet energetic atmosphere where residents enjoy easy access to the ocean, beach volleyball courts, surfing, bike paths, and year-round outdoor living. Buyers searching for Hermosa Beach homes for sale are often drawn to the combination of coastal charm, community events, and proximity to both Los Angeles and other South Bay beach cities.

Hermosa Beach real estate is commonly divided into two main areas. The Sand Section includes properties west of Pacific Coast Highway, closer to the beach, Pier Avenue, and the Strand, where homes range from classic beach cottages to modern luxury residences with ocean views. The neighborhoods east of PCH, often referred to as the Hill Section, offer more residential settings with hillside streets, some elevated views, and convenient access to local parks and schools. Understanding these micro-areas is important when evaluating Hermosa Beach real estate values and lifestyle preferences.

Families are attracted to Hermosa Beach for its strong sense of community and its dedicated local schools, including Hermosa View and Hermosa Valley School for elementary and middle school students. For high school, residents typically attend either Redondo Union High School or Mira Costa High School, giving families access to two well-regarded options in the South Bay.

Downtown Hermosa Beach along Pier Avenue serves as the heart of the city, with restaurants, cafés, shops, and nightlife creating a dynamic social environment. 19,248 people live in Hermosa Beach, where the median age is 42.1 and the average individual income is $110,660.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
